Blood technician arrested by the PJ suspended from duties and banned from entering Coimbra by the court

The blood technician arrested on Wednesday on suspicion of embezzlement, corruption of substances, and/or spreading disease was banned by the court on Friday, April 24, from entering Coimbra and suspended from his duties, the Judiciary Police (PJ) announced. Avelino Lima, director of the PJ's Central Directorate, stated that all proposed coercive measures were accepted by the judge at the Coimbra District Court. The 66-year-old suspect is prohibited from visiting his workplace at the Blood and Transplantation Centre in São Martinho do Bispo and from contacting witnesses or staff. The investigation, which began in January following a report from the Portuguese Institute of Blood and Transplantation (IPST), suggests the suspect stole and manipulated sterile connection blades used in blood component production to sell the copper for profit, potentially risking contamination of blood products.
